The Regulatory Framework: Balancing Innovation and Consumer Protection
Online casino regulation varies significantly across jurisdictions, often posing a challenge for operators seeking to maintain compliance while delivering seamless user experiences. Countries like the United Kingdom maintain rigorous licensing standards through the UK Gambling Commission, emphasizing player protection, anti-money laundering measures, and fair gaming practices. Conversely, other regions, like certain Eastern European markets, have more fragmented frameworks, complicating cross-border operations.
Ensuring compliance involves navigating a complex web of legal requirements, licensing fees, and ongoing audits. Failure to adhere risks hefty fines, license revocation, and reputation damage. Industry analysts highlight that adherence to regulatory standards not only mitigates legal threats but also enhances consumer confidence—a critical factor in a competitive environment where players seek trustworthy platforms.
User Support and Responsible Gambling: Core Pillars of Trust
Beyond legal compliance, a core focus for reputable online casinos is providing comprehensive user support, especially in aspects related to responsible gambling. This includes features such as self-exclusion tools, deposit limits, and real-time activity monitoring, enabling players to control their gaming habits.
For example, advanced platforms leverage data analytics to identify problematic behaviors early, prompting intervention. As part of their due diligence, operators often refer players to trusted resources and support services, aligning with best practices outlined by gaming authorities.
